Manutenzjoni
Manutenzjoni xierqa testendi l-ħajja u d-dehra tat-tenda tiegħek.
- Tindif tad-Drapp: Clean the awning fabric regularly with mild soap and water. Use a soft brush or sponge. Rinse thoroughly with clean water and allow it to air dry completely before retracting. Do not use har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ners.
- Tindif tal-qafas: Imsaħ il-qafas tal-aluminju b'reklamaramp drapp biex tneħħi l-ħmieġ u t-trab.
- Lubrikazzjoni: Periodically apply a silicone-based lubricant to moving parts, such as the arm joints and crank mechanism, to ensure smooth operation.
- Spezzjoni: Regularly check all bolts, screws, and connections for tightness. Tighten any loose fasteners. Inspect the fabric for tears or damage.
- Ħażna tax-Xitwa: In areas with harsh winters, it is recommended to keep the awning fully retracted when not in use for extended periods or during heavy snowfall.

Issolvi l-problemi
| Problema | Kawża Possibbli | Soluzzjoni |
|---|---|---|
| It-tenda ma testendix jew tinġibed lura bla xkiel. | Mechanism is dry or dirty; obstruction in the arms. | Lubricate moving parts with silicone spray. Check for and remove any obstructions. |
| Awning sags or is not level. | Mounting brackets are not level or loose; arms are not properly adjusted. | Check and re-level mounting brackets. Ensure all fasteners are tight. Adjust arm tension if applicable (refer to detailed manual). |
| Fabric collects water. | Awning angle is too flat. | Adjust the awning's pitch to a steeper angle (within 5-35° range) to allow water runoff. |
| It-tined jagħmel ħsejjes mhux tas-soltu waqt l-operazzjoni. | Nuqqas ta' lubrikazzjoni; komponenti maħlula. | Lubricate all moving parts. Inspect and tighten any loose bolts or screws. |
